A totally dependable choice for dining while at the Broadway Plaza shopping center, Marketplace Cafe at Nordstroms can be found on the 3rd floor. Lots of seating inside, which was pretty full of Christmas shoppers because it was too chilly to eat out on the patio. You can grab a menu at the station at the entrance. Or use the QR code to view it on your phone, except for the specials menu. Order at the counter, take a number, and they bring the food to your table. The specials on my visit included a wine flight, spiced apple sangria, and a ribeye steak. Good variety, which is necessary to be a crowd pleaser at the mall: soups and starters, salads, pizza, pasta, entrees and sandwiches. I ordered a cilantro lime signature salad, which comes with baby greens, jack cheese, tomatoes, pumpkin seeds, tortilla crisps and a cilantro lime vinaigrette. I got it with salmon, which brought the price to a reasonable $21. Delicious dressing. Not the best piece of Alaskan Sockeye I've ever had, but this was a quick lunch at the mall. Open 11-7 most days, 11-5 on Sundays.

The Marketplace Cafe is on the third level of Nordstrom in Walnut Creek. We have been many times for lunch while shopping in the area. They offer a wide variety of salads, soups, and sandwichs and some very nice desert items. We particularly enjoy seating on their outdoor roof top patio featuring views of Mt. Diablo. The prawn salad is a particular favorite. Highly recommended.Kid-friendliness: Kids are welcome.Wheelchair accessibility: Fully accessible.
